Import of Pigeon (peas (Cajanus cajan) / Toor Dal - Import of restricted item or not - validity of notification - As far as the DGFT is concerned, the power has been given to the Director General of Foreign Trade, the Additional Director General and others to sign to authenticate all instruments made and executed in the name of the President of India (Rule 12). - there is no merit in the contention urged by the learned counsel for the petitioner.
